Understanding Exchange Fees
Before diving into the very Best Lowest Fee Crypto Exchange Low Cost Crypto Exchange-fee exchanges, it's vital to comprehend the kinds of fees commonly connected with cryptocurrency trading:
Trading fees: Fees charged when buying or selling cryptocurrencies.Withdrawal fees: Charges for transferring crypto out of the exchange to a wallet.Deposit fees: Fees sustained when including funds to the exchange.Lack of exercise fees: Charges used when an account is inactive for a given period.
Some exchanges have no trading fees but may impose high withdrawal fees, which can affect your overall success.

Why do crypto exchanges charge fees?
Crypto exchanges charge fees to cover operating expense, including security, innovation, and client service personnel expenses.
2. What is the difference in between maker and taker fees?Maker fees use when you include liquidity to the order book by positioning a limit order, whereas taker fees use when you get rid of liquidity by executing an order versus an existing one.3. Are zero-fee exchanges trusted?
Not necessarily. Some zero-fee exchanges may make up for the lost income with higher withdrawal fees or may have hidden charges. Research is crucial for ensuring dependability.
4. Can fees change with time?
Yes, fees can change based upon trading volume, exchange policies, and market conditions. Constantly describe the exchange's main fee schedule for updates.
5. What are KYC requirements, and why do they matter?
KYC (Know Your Customer) requirements are regulative procedures that exchanges follow to confirm the identity of users. This process improves security and compliance but might decrease the onboarding process.
